Nepal Tsum Velly Trek / Manaslu Tsum valley Trek

It is a sacred Himalayan pilgrimage valley situated in northern Gorkha, Nepal. 'Tsum' comes from the Tibetan word 'Tsombo',which means vivid Traditionally, Tsum valley was a currently distinct geographical area called 'Tsum Tso Chucksums', which means thirteen provinces ruled as a single territory. Against the majestic backdrop of the Ganesh Himal,Sringi Himal,Boudha Himal ranges, this serene Himalayan valley is rich in ancient art, culture and religion. The local people are mostly of Tibetan origin & speak their own dialect. The altitude of Tsum Valley trek varies from 1905m in Lhokpa to over 5093m at Ngula Dhojhyang pass on the Tibatan border. The hidden valley is surrounded by the Boudha Himal and Himal chuli to the west, Ganesh Himal to the south & Sringi Himal to North.

People in Tsum Valley still practice polyandry system and they have their own unique culture, tradition, & dialect. They celebrate unique festival like Lhosar, Dhacyhang, Saka Dawa, Faning & others. Many residents of this valley report that they have seen or found the signs of Mehti, commonly referred as the 'Yeti' or 'Abominable Snowman'.

The trials are strewn with artistic chortens and lined with Mani walls made of thousands of stone slabs carved with drawings of deities and inscribed with prayers. The famous Kyimo Lung, a pilgrimage circuit in the central Trans-Himalaya is a well known seat of learning and a seat of meditation. The circuit traverses across Tsum Valley, Manaslu area in Nepal and southern parts of Tibet. The Buddhist saint Milarepa is believed to have meditated in the caves of these mountains. Due to its remoteness and inaccessibility, this sacred valley and its people have been bypassed by mainstream development for centuries. As a result, the unique culture of this valley has also remained fairly intact. This trek begins from Arughat in Gorkha district, which is easily accessible from Kathmandu.

Program Outline

  • Trekking Days -› (17)
  • Total Days -› (21)
  • Min. Altitude -› (537m./1762ft.)
  • Max. Altitude -› (3700m./12139ft.)
  • Walking Per Day -› 5-7hrs
  • Route Nature -› Camping [Fully Organized Trekking]
  • Difficulty -› Medium
  • Season -› Aug-Dec. / Feb-May..

    Program Itinerary (Short)

    Day 01: Arrival then transfer to Hotel O/N Hotel
    Day 02: Half Day sightseeing and prepare for trek O/N Hotel
    Day  03: Drive  from Kathmandu to Arughat O/N Camp (535m-10 hours by bus)
    Day  04:  Trek from Arughat to Liding O/N Camp (860m-7km-4 hours walk)
    Day  05:  Trek to Machhakhola O/N Camp (930m-9km-5 hours walk)
    Day  06:  Trek to Jagat O/N Camp (1410m-11km-6hours walk)
    Day  07:  Trek to Lokpa O/N Camp (2040m-10km-5 hours walk)
    Day  08:  Trek to Chunling O/N Camp (2363m-7km-3.5 hours walk)
    Day  09:  Trek to Chhokangparo O/N Camp (3010m-13km-8 hours walk)
    Day  10:  Trek to Chhule-Nile O/N Camp (3361m-9km-4.5 hours walk)
    Day  11:  Trek to Mu Gompa O/N Camp (3700m-5km-3 hours walk)
    Day  12:  Trek to Rachen Gompa O/N Camp (3240m-8km-4.5 hours walk)
    Day  13:  Trek to Dumje O/N Camp (2440m-11km-6.5 hours walk)
    Day  14:  Trek to Gumba Lungdang O/N Camp (3200m-6.5km-4 hours walk)
    Day  15:  Trek to Ripchet O/N Camp (2468m-9km-5 hours walk)
    Day  16:  Trek to Dobhan O/N Camp (1070m-14km-7 hours walk)
    Day  17:  Trek to Soti Khola O/N Camp  (720m-18km-9 hours walk)
    Day  18:  Trek to Arughat O/N Camp (535m-7km- 4 hours walk)
    Day  19:  Drive to Kathmandu O/N Hotel (10 hours by bus)
    Day 20:  Free Day at Kathmandu O/N Hotel
    Day 21:  Transfer to airport for final departure!!!!!
